2018 USA Diving Senior Nationals To Be Held In Dallas

USA Diving announced today that the 2018 USA Diving Senior National Championships will be held on the campus of Southern Methodist University in Dallas, Texas, May 13-20. The meet will be held at the new Robson & Lindley Aquatics Center.

“We are constantly looking to elevate the sport of diving in the U.S. and having our national championships at SMU holds true to that effort,” said USA Diving CEO Lee Johnson. “Having the best divers in the country at a brand-new facility is the perfect combination for a marquee event.”

The meet will also serve as the selection event for the 2018 FINA World Cup, the top international competition of the 2018 season. The World Cup will be held June 5-10 in Wuhan, China.

“The national championships will offer a great opportunity for America’s top divers to compete not only for national titles, but for spots on the World Cup team,” said USA Diving High Performance Director Kevin Ankrom. “This meet will bring out the best in our divers and will ultimately produce a team that will be ready for Wuhan.”

The 2018 USA Diving Senior National Championships – National Qualifier will be held May 10-11, also at SMU, to give divers not already qualified for the meet an opportunity to earn their spot into the competition.

Divers will be vying for 12 national titles, with titles to be awarded in individual 1-meter, 3-meter and 10-meter and synchronized 3-meter and 10-meter for both men and women. Mixed synchronized 3-meter and 10-meter titles will also be awarded.
